GCN Circular 25380

Subject
Baksan Neutrino Observatory Alert 190817.35 Global MASTER-Net observations report

MASTER-OAFA robotic telescope  (Global MASTER-Net: http://observ.pereplet.ru, Lipunov et al., 2010, Advances in Astronomy, vol. 2010, 30L)  located in Argentina (OAFA observatory of San Juan National University) started inspect of the Baksan Neutrino Observatory Alert 190817.35 (  1h 21m 12.00s , -22d  0m 00.00s, R=3) errorbox  10 sec after notice time and 1220 sec after trigger time at 2019-08-17 08:45:22 UT, with upper limit up to  17.5 mag. The observations began at zenit distance = 11 deg. The sun  altitude  is -31.2 deg. 

The galactic latitude b = -60 deg., longitude l = 98 deg.

We obtain a following upper limits.  

Tmid-T0  |      Date Time      |          Site       |             Coord (J2000)          |Filt.| Expt. | Limit| Comment
_________|_____________________|_____________________|____________________________________|_____|_______|_______|________

    1311 | 2019-08-17 08:45:22 |         MASTER-OAFA | (  1h 20m 13.42s , -22d  7m 27.37s) |   C |   180 | 16.7 |        
    1491 | 2019-08-17 08:45:22 |         MASTER-OAFA | (  1h 20m 13.42s , -22d  7m 27.42s) |   C |   540 | 17.5 |  Coadd 
    1535 | 2019-08-17 08:49:07 |         MASTER-OAFA | (  1h 20m 13.19s , -22d  7m 27.40s) |   C |   180 | 16.9 |        
    1759 | 2019-08-17 08:52:50 |         MASTER-OAFA | (  1h 20m 13.09s , -22d  7m 27.30s) |   C |   180 | 16.9 |        
    1984 | 2019-08-17 08:56:35 |         MASTER-OAFA | (  1h 20m 13.04s , -22d  7m 27.59s) |   C |   180 | 17.0 |        
Filter C is a clear (unfiltred) band.
